#ec4cb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ec4cbd is composed of 92.5% red, 29.8%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 19.9%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 317.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#ec4cb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#d9007b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#ec4cbd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ec4cbd has RGB values of R:236, G:76,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.2,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15486141.

Shades and Tints of #ec4cb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ec4cb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0989e is the less saturated color, while #fb3dc3 is the most saturated one.
